Kwinkqubo ye-photovoltaic (PV), umbane oveliswayo usetyenziselwa ikakhulu ukukhulisa imithwalo. Xa ukuveliswa kudlula imfuno yomthwalo, umbane ogqithisileyo ubuyela kwigridi, nto leyo edala "umbane obuyela umva." Imithetho yegridi idla ngokuthintela ukubuya kombane okungavumelekanga, kwaye ukondla umbane okungagunyaziswanga kunokubangela izohlwayo. Kwiiprojekthi ze-PV ezenzelwe ukuzisebenzisa ngaphandle kokondla umbane, ukhuseleko lokulwa nokubuyela umva lubalulekile ekufezekiseni ukuzimela kwamandla okuzinzileyo.
Yintoni i-Anti-Backflow?
Kwinkqubo ye-PV, iimodyuli zelanga zivelisa umsinga othe ngqo (DC), oguqulwa ube ngumsinga otshintshanayo (AC) yi-inverter ukuze unikezele ngemithwalo yendawo. Ukuba ukuveliswa kudlula ukusetyenziswa, umbane ongaphezulu ubuyela kwigridi, nto leyo edala ukubuya kombane. Iinkqubo ezisebenza ngokulwa nokubuyela umva zinokulungisa imveliso ye-inverter ukuqinisekisa ukuba umbane oveliswayo usetyenziswa ngokupheleleyo yimithwalo yendawo, ukuthintela amandla agqithisileyo ukuba angangeni kwigridi.
Kutheni Ufakela i-Anti-Backflow?
Izizathu eziphambili zokufaka i-anti-backflow ziquka:
1. Imida yoMgaqo-nkqubo weGridi:Kwezinye iindawo, imiqathango okanye imigaqo-nkqubo yegridi iyakwalela ukufaka umbane kwigridi. Ukubuyela umva okungagunyaziswanga kunokukhokelela kwizohlwayo.
2. Imida yoQhagamshelo lweGridi:Igridi ibeka imida engqongqo kubungakanani bamandla anokufakwa kuyo. Ukudlula le mida ngaphandle kolawulo kunokuphazamisa uzinzo lwegridi.
3. Umgaqo Wokuzisebenzisa:Iinkqubo ze-PV ezenzelwe ukuzisebenzisa zibeka phambili ukusetyenziswa komthwalo kwindawo ethile. Naliphi na amandla agqithisileyo kufuneka avalwe ukuba angangeni kwigridi kusetyenziswa izixhobo ezichasene nokuhamba kwamanzi.
Umgaqo-nkqubo Wokusebenza Wokulwa Nokubuyela Umva
Iinkqubo ze-anti-backflow zihlala ziquka i-anti-backflow meter kunye ne-current transformer (CT) efakwe kumgca oyintloko. Ezi zixhobo zilinganisa amandla exesha langempela kunye nokuhamba kwamandla e-current. Xa umbane obuyela umva ufunyenwe, i-meter idlulisela idatha yokuhamba kwamandla e-backflow kwi-inverter ngonxibelelwano lwe-RS485. I-inverter iphendula kwimizuzwana embalwa, inciphisa amandla ayo okukhupha ukuqinisekisa ukuba ukuhamba kwamandla e-current kwi-grid kuphantse kube zero.
Izisombululo zokungabuyeli emva kokuhamba
Kukho iindlela ezahlukeneyo zokulungiselela ukuhlangabezana neemeko ezahlukeneyo:
1. Isisombululo seNkqubo yokuLwa nokuBuya kweMigca esiSigaba esinye
· Izixhobo ezifunekayo: i-inverter ebotshelelwe kwigridi, imitha yokulinganisa ukuhamba kwamanzi, kunye nentambo yonxibelelwano.
· Ifanelekile kwiinkqubo ze-PV zokuhlala ezincinci.
2. Isisombululo seNkqubo yokuLwa nokuBuya kweMigca esiPhakathi esiThathu
· Kwiinkqubo zokuhlala ezisebenzisa amandla aphantsi, iimitha ze-DC ezichasene nokubuyela umva zinokuqhagamshelwa ngokuthe ngqo kwiiterminal ze-AC zokukhupha ze-inverter.
· Kwiinkqubo zamandla aphezulu, ii-CT transformers zibona umsinga kwindawo yoqhagamshelo lwegridi. Isiphumo se-CT siyalinganiswa size sifakwe kwimitha echasene nokubuyela umva ukuze kulinganiswe amandla ngokuchanekileyo.
3. Isisombululo seNkqubo ye-Multi-Inverter Anti-Backflow
· Ii-inverters ezininzi ziqhagamshelwe kwi-data logger nge-interfaces zonxibelelwano.
· Esi sisombululo sifanelekile kwiisetingi ezinkulu, sinika amandla aphezulu kunye nokusebenza okuqinileyo.
